2023 Lexus RX launched in India at a starting price of Rs 95.80 lakh

The new 2023 Lexus RX Hybrid SUV has been launched in India at a starting price of Rs 95.80 lakh. The high-end RX500h F-Sport+ gets a price tag of Rs 1.18 crore. The RX 350h Luxury variant is priced at Rs 95.80 lakh. The luxury SUV was showcased at Auto Expo earlier this year.

2023 Lexus RX: Everything you need to know

In terms of design, the new Lexus RX draws a lot of cues from the new RZ EV. The ‘spindle body’ and Alluring X Verve design can be found on the new luxury SUV. Lexus RX stands at dimensions of 4,890mm x 1,920mm x 1,650mm. The SUV has a wheelbase of 2,850mm. The 2023 Lexus is wider and has a larger wheelbase than its predecessor. The two variants share the same overall design but the RX 500h F-Sport+ variant gets piano black accents instead of chrome inserts.

Inside, the Lexus RX gets a 14-inch touchscreen infotainment system with Android Auto and Apple CarPlay. The interiors get Lexus’ Tazuna design, which seeks to establish a better connection between the car and the driver. The SUV also gets wireless charging and a head-up display. Lexus RX is available in three interior colour options – Black, Dark Sepia, and Solis White. 

The 2023 Lexus RX comes in two powertrain options. The RX 350h Luxury variant is powered by a 2.5-litre petrol engine. In conjunction with the electric motor, this unit produces a maximum power output of 250hp and 242Nm of torque. This engine combination is paired with a CVT.

The RX500h F-Sport is powered by a 2.4-litre turbo petrol engine which, paired with an electric motor, produces a maximum power output of 371hp and 460Nm of torque. This variant gets a 6-speed automatic transmission. The RX500h can go from 0-100 kmph in 6.2 seconds and can achieve a top speed of 210kmph.

Conclusion

At Rs 95.80 lakh, the Lexus RX is pretty aggressively priced with its competitors – unlike the previous Lexus models. The luxury SUV rivals the likes of Mercedes-Benz GLE, BMW X5, Jeep Grand Cherokee, Range Rover Velar, Jaguar F-Pace, and Audi Q7.
